/**
* Tests resolution of implemented/extended types
*
* @author Takeshi D. Itoh
*/
class ImplementedOrExtendedTypeResolutionTest extends AbstractResolutionTest {

@BeforeAll
static void configureSymbolSolver() throws IOException {
// configure symbol solver before parsing
CombinedTypeSolver typeSolver = new CombinedTypeSolver();
typeSolver.add(new ReflectionTypeSolver());
StaticJavaParser.getConfiguration().setSymbolResolver(new JavaSymbolSolver(typeSolver));
}

@AfterAll
static void unConfigureSymbolSolver() {
// unconfigure symbol solver so as not to potentially disturb tests in other classes
StaticJavaParser.getConfiguration().setSymbolResolver(null);
}

@Test
void solveImplementedTypes() {
CompilationUnit cu = parseSample("ImplementedOrExtendedTypeResolution");
ClassOrInterfaceDeclaration clazz = Navigator.demandClass(cu, "InterfaceTest");
assertEquals(clazz.getFieldByName("field_i1").get().resolve().getType().describe(), "I1");
assertEquals(clazz.getFieldByName("field_i2").get().resolve().getType().describe(), "I2.I2_1");
assertEquals(clazz.getFieldByName("field_i3").get().resolve().getType().describe(), "I3.I3_1.I3_1_1");
}

@Test
void solveExtendedType1() {
CompilationUnit cu = parseSample("ImplementedOrExtendedTypeResolution");
ClassOrInterfaceDeclaration clazz = Navigator.demandClass(cu, "ClassTest1");
assertEquals(clazz.getFieldByName("field_c1").get().resolve().getType().describe(), "C1");
}

@Test
void solveExtendedType2() {
CompilationUnit cu = parseSample("ImplementedOrExtendedTypeResolution");
ClassOrInterfaceDeclaration clazz = Navigator.demandClass(cu, "ClassTest2");
assertEquals(clazz.getFieldByName("field_c2").get().resolve().getType().describe(), "C2.C2_1");
}

@Test
void solveExtendedType3() {
CompilationUnit cu = parseSample("ImplementedOrExtendedTypeResolution");
ClassOrInterfaceDeclaration clazz = Navigator.demandClass(cu, "ClassTest3");
assertEquals(clazz.getFieldByName("field_c3").get().resolve().getType().describe(), "C3.C3_1.C3_1_1");
}

}
